Open journal →The story
Civil engineer George Castleman leaves his wife Mildred in the city and goes South to supervise the construction of a railroad. Not one to be alone for long, Mildred quickly begins an affair with the wealthy and dissolute Arnold Morgan, while George becomes friends with Zell, who lives in the mountains. When George tells Zell about his unhappy marriage, she goes to Mildred, hoping to bring about a reconciliation between her and George. Mildred, however, views Zell's relationship with George as the grounds for divorce that she has been trying to find for so long. She and her lawyer follow Zell back to the mountains, but they die in an accident en route. Zell and George then realize that they love each other and make plans for their life together.
